Subject: Handing off PedalShift releases

Hey folks,

I'm moving teams, so PedalShift's rebalancing tool is yours now. Releases cut every other Thursday; the van-routing solver gets packaged first, then the dispatcher UI. Nothing exotic, but don't skip the dry-run against the Harrowgate depot fixtures. To push signed builds to the fleet gateway, you'll need the key below.

signing key of bagap-yawep = bky13_TbfT6ZMUoGJo2

/*
 * VALIDATOR_PLUGIN_ABI_VERSION — Quillforge plugin system.
 * External validator plugins must declare the ABI version they target;
 * the loader refuses mismatches at registration time rather than failing
 * mid-batch. Bump this constant only alongside a migration note in the
 * plugin author guide, since third-party authors pin against it. Never
 * reuse a retired version number. The value below was stamped by the
 * release pipeline, and its provenance token follows.
 */

build token for kagaf-hahof: htk14_9d3d4d26d7d8de

State: render path for plugin-supplied templates is ~40% slower since the Quillbase 3.2 parser swap. Root cause is repeated AST re-validation per request; caching layer exists but is disabled for third-party templates pending sandbox review. Short-term: advise plugin authors to precompile with `qb-compile` and ship the artifact. Don't touch the validator flags — Marisol owns those. Benchmarks live in the perf harness; run before and after any change. Full notes and flamegraphs are on the internal page linked below.

dashboard of kahop-tahop = https://jira.tolvaqsys.internal/projects/projects/browse/browse/a7d3